Quickcard: International Academy of Detoxification Specialists
94-3382902
“The primary purpose of the Academy is to provide information to physicians, public health specialists, researchers, health care providers and others interested in implementing the detoxification procedure developed by L. Ron Hubbard to treat the effect of chemical exposures and drug abuse. “The Academy also supports efforts by its members to assist public health officials and health care providers to implement detoxification on a humanitarian basis. “In 2005, the Academy also began itself to operate a clinic for delivery of the detoxification procedure on a humanitarian basis.”
